Recipes: BBQ brisket sliders paired with an espresso old fashioned

Flight Club Denver's chef and mixologist collaborated to create this savory meal designed to pair perfectly with their aromatic and roasty Espresso Old Fashioned. BBQ Brisket Sliders

Sandwich ingredients
3 slider buns
6 oz beef, brisket cooked 
2 fl oz BBQ sauce
60 g shaved red cabbage 
0.5 oz shaved carrot 
Dill pickle, crinkle cut

Instructions 
Steam brisket for 20 minutes. Once complete, drain and shred the meat with a fork, add BBQ sauce, reduce and keep warm.
Toast slider buns. Scoop the brisket and begin assembling the sandwich. 
Mix dressing with shredded cabbage and carrots, add mixed slaw to the sandwich.
Top with bun and add pickle curved over a skewer.

Dressing ingredients
80 g dijonnaise 
2 fl oz white wine vinegar
30 g honey 
30 g plain Greek yogurt
1 tsp salt & pepper, mixed 

Instructions
Combine Dijonnaise, yogurt, honey, white wine vinegar and S&P to taste.


Espresso Old Fashioned

Ingredients
2 oz Stranahan’s Whiskey
0.5 oz Real Vanilla Syrup
1.5 oz Owen's Cold Brew Mix
3 dashes Scrappy's Chocolate Bitters

Instructions
Add all ingredients to mixing tin with cubed ice and stir. Add more cubed ice and stir until chilled. Strain into glass with fresh, cubed ice. Garnish with an orange peel
